## Tuning

Quick heads-up for review: the Papertrout invoice renderer caps embedded image size and font subsetting depth mainly to keep malicious PDFs from chewing up a worker. Nothing here is secret — just sanity limits. If you bump any of these, think about decompression-bomb exposure first, since the parser trusts these bounds. The current production values are as follows.

limits module of fajog-tawig:
RATE_LIMITS = {
    "druwyn": 2,
    "quenael": 10,
    "wenix": 2,
    "druael": 2,
}

## Fleet Fuel Report — Onboarding

The weekly fuel-usage report for the Haulbright fleet is generated by the `fuelsum` job on Tornvale infra. It pulls odometer and pump data from DepotSync, aggregates per vehicle class, and posts to the release channel every Monday. Do not edit the template directly; changes go through review. To trigger a manual run, call the internal API with the key below.

gateway credential: kto23_LX9A4ys6i4nzHtpOLNLodKK

Hi Devan,

Handover note for the sync: the `orders` table on Lanternfish prod still has roughly 2,100 rows soft-deleted during Tuesday's migration but never purged. I've confirmed the `deleted_at` index is healthy and reporting excludes them correctly. Hold the purge job until the finance snapshot completes. Flag any anomalies to the address below.

Thanks,
Mira

escalation mailbox, hadug-bajog: sormir@norvalabs.internal

## Deployment

Gridsmith builds via the standard pipeline. Push to main, CI generates the puzzle corpus, artifacts go to the Fenwick cluster. Rollbacks: redeploy the prior tag, nothing else needed. Clue cache is rebuilt on boot, expect ~2 min warmup. The deployed service reads the configuration shown below.

settings of kajep-kawip:
[zorys]
host = zorys.urlaqgrid.corp
user = zorys_svc
database = zorys_prod